Cyprus, Kition AR Stater. Azbaal, circa 449-425 BC. Herakles in fighting stance to right, wearing lion skin upon his back and tied around neck, holding club overhead in right hand and bow extended before him in left hand; monogram or ankh to right / Lion attacking stag crouching right; L'Z'B'L (in Aramaic) above; all inside dotted border within incuse square. Zapiti & Michaelidou 5-6; Tziambazis 17; BMCRE 16-8; cf. Roma XIX, 577 (same obv. die). 11.12g, 26mm, 6h.
Very Fine; struck from a worn obv. die, which would appear to have been used for striking coins of a similar type for the following ruler, Baalmelek II (c. 425-400 BC; cf. Roma XIX, 577).
